Question by Reality.: Where can I find rental car auctions?
Can anyone tell me where I can find the lists, times and locations of rental car auctions? I would like to buy a used rental car, but have only been able to locate the Enterprise rental car sales site and they don’t have the vehicle that I am looking for.
Apparently I was laboring under the misconception that these places offered actual auctions as opposed to retail sales. From what I’ve seen so far, they offer nothing different than any other used car dealers, meaning retail. Being an educated consumer is a lesson in frustration. Argh!

Best answer:

Answer by pingraham@sbcglobal.net
Each company holds its own auctions, so you’ll need to contact each one to find out when they hold their auctions.
There may be some information on their websites – and they all have them – Avis, Hertz, Budget – but, for better local information, telephone or e-mail your local region manager. They are usualy listed either on the website or in your local Yellow Pages.
Or call your local or 800 number to find out who you should speak with.

  1. A lot of rental car agencies sell through wholesale auto auctions which are only open to registered dealers. If your a dealer or know one who can buy at the auctions then manheim auto auctions is nationwide and handles alot of the rental car sales.
